Santosh Agrawal (@santgra) reported@Airtel_Presence @airtelindia As an Airtel Black subscriber, I made the apparently unreasonable request of having my fiber connection switched from NAT mode to bridge mode. To Airtel’s credit, the configuration change was completed promptly the very next day. Unfortunately, that seems to be where competence ended. What none of your support personnel, across multiple support tickets and at least three levels of escalation, appear to understand is that when an ONT/router is configured in bridge mode, the subscriber requires PPPoE credentials to actually access the Internet. This is not an exotic networking concept. It is Networking 101. As a result, my broadband connection remains unusable. Since my Airtel TV set-top boxes also depend on this connection, my television services are down as well. My professional work has been impacted, and I have spent days educating your support teams about the basics of the service they are supposed to support. My current ticket number is: 11032477458.
